Whether it’s *Eclipsed*, *ROCKS*, *Good Times*, or *Classic Rock*: Almost all the major rock magazines are currently falling over themselves with rave reviews and full-page features on FLYING CIRCUS and their latest album, *The Eternal Moment*.
ROCKS editor-in-chief Daniel Böhm himself describes the group from the Rhineland as “a band that deserves all of our attention,” and Joe Asmodo from eclipsed compares them to Deep Purple and Black Sabbath as well as King Crimson and Yes—a spectrum ranging from powerful hard rock to dexterous prog, a space where FLYING CIRCUS themselves feel very much at home and would likely cite Led Zeppelin, Kansas (the violin!), and Pink Floyd as further points of reference.
And this is by no means just “critics’ love”: Even before their latest album, “The Eternal Moment,” their previous two studio releases each spent a full ten weeks in the Top 20 of the German rock/metal charts—and in 2022, Deutschlandfunk even dedicated a one-hour feature to the band on “Rock et cetera.” No wonder, then, that Flying Circus is currently considered one of the hottest hidden gems on the German scene.
In short: If you’re into sophisticated ’70s rock of all kinds but would rather experience fresh compositions “in the classic style”—performed in an absolutely captivating way—instead of tribute bands, you definitely shouldn’t miss FLYING CIRCUS.
Flying Circus has secured the Hamburg-based band Johnny Bob as a special guest; with five albums to their credit, Johnny Bob has also already made a name for itself in the German progressive rock scene. As early as their second album, “Fjodor and the Watergiant,” the magazine “eclipsed” predicted that the band—which always delivers compelling live performances—would “soon become one of the biggest bands on the national progressive scene.” A promise that Johnny Bob certainly fulfilled with their concept album “The Glass Hotel Tapes,” if not sooner.
Despite audible nods to the genre’s classic bands, neither band sees itself as a retro act—rather, they are musicians who, while carrying their formative influences in their DNA, recombine these elements into fresh, exciting, and original rock music.
